Orobanche parishii ssp. brachyloba
Orobanche parishii (Jeps.) Heckard ssp. brachyloba Heckard
Parish's Broom Rape, Parish's Broomrape, Short Lobed Broom Rape, Short-lobed Broomrape
Orobanchaceae (Broom-rape family)
Synonym(s):
USDA Symbol: ORPAB
USDA Native Status: L48 (N)
Plants in this family are parasitic on roots or stems of other plants, to varying degrees, from hemiparasitic to holoparasitic.

Plant Characteristics
Duration: AnnualHabit: Herb
Fruit Type: Capsule
Size Notes: Up to about 8 inches tall.
Bloom Information
Bloom Color: White , Red , PinkBloom Time: Apr , May , Jun , Jul , Aug , Sep , Oct
Distribution
USA: CANative Habitat: Sandy soil near coast, usually on Isocoma menziesii.
